He Was...

312 35 6
                                    

He was moon, he was star

He was every constellation that seemed so far.

He was passion, he was serenity

He was the place where I want to be.

He was laugh, he was cry

He was the million dots in the sky.

He was sunset, he was sunrise

He was beautiful city lights.

He was the quote in my favorite book,

And the risks I never took.

He was the song in my head,

And the words left unsaid.

He was the thing I craved,

And the mistake I never made.

He was the dreams every night,

The reason I held onto tight.

He was summer, he was fall

He was the love letters at my door.

He was the prize at the end of the finish line,

I should've known these when he was mine.
